1. Lack of Clear Objectives
One of the most significant missteps in Salesforce implementations is not having clearly defined objectives. Without specific goals, it’s challenging to align the platform’s capabilities with business needs, leading to wasted resources and unmet expectations.
- Determine the core functionalities your organization seeks from Salesforce based on current challenges and future growth plans.
- Engage stakeholders early in the process to gather diverse perspectives and ensure that objectives align with overall business strategies.
2. Inadequate Training and Change Management
Successful adoption of Salesforce hinges on effective training and change management. Many organizations underestimate the importance of preparing their teams for a transition to a new system, resulting in resistance and underutilization.
- Develop comprehensive training programs tailored to different user roles within the organization.
- Incorporate change management strategies to facilitate smoother transitions and encourage adoption.
3. Poor Data Quality and Integration Issues
Data is the lifeblood of Salesforce, yet many implementations falter due to poor data quality or integration challenges with existing systems. This can lead to inefficiencies and errors in customer management.
- Conduct thorough data audits prior to implementation to ensure accuracy and completeness.
- Leverage Salesforce’s robust API capabilities for seamless integration with other tools and platforms used by your business.
4. Ignoring User Feedback
User feedback is invaluable in refining the Salesforce setup to better meet organizational needs. Overlooking this input can result in a system that doesn’t fully address user requirements or workflows.
- Establish regular feedback loops with end-users throughout the implementation process.
- Be responsive and adaptable to suggestions for improvements, making necessary adjustments to configurations and features.
5. Choosing the Wrong Salesforce Package or Edition
Selecting an inappropriate Salesforce package can lead to significant limitations in functionality and scalability. It’s crucial to choose a version that aligns with both current needs and future growth plans.
- Evaluate all available Salesforce editions against your business requirements before making a decision.

6. Underestimating Implementation Complexity
The complexity of Salesforce implementations is often underestimated by organizations, leading to unexpected delays and budget overruns.
- Create a detailed implementation plan that includes timelines, resource allocations, and contingency measures.

7. Neglecting Ongoing Support and Maintenance
A Salesforce system is not a set-it-and-forget-it solution. Regular support and maintenance are essential to ensure it continues to meet business needs effectively over time.
- Schedule regular reviews and updates for your Salesforce configuration to incorporate new features and address evolving requirements.
